Re: 330 Lightshow
Gary, it's 1 megohm, audio taper. The sensitivity pot on an original 331LS is 25Kohm, audio taper. But it works differently.
I don't know what you mean by "panels aren't very thick". They are the same thickness as an original LS, .125" acrylic with the swirly lens adding another .025" to the thickness. They go on on top of the body, as do those on an original. The limiting factor in the whole shebang is the thickness of the stuffed circuit board, which won't clear the pot bottoms on a solid body Rick--it's a smidge too thin. But I'm working on a solution to this.

The issue with lamps clearing the underside of the plastic is different with my SS than it is with an original. At least on a Type 2, the bulbs sit high on PC board sockets which themselves waste almost 1/4" of space under each bulb. Add the height of the original, lozenge-shaped bulb, and you're nearly touching the plastic Rowlux. The circuit boards on the Type 2 are 2mm thick glass fiber, screwed to the back of the guitar body.
With my SS version, the 5mm hi-intensity LEDs are only 6mm high, added to the 3mm thick mirrored acrylic backing. Total about .375" high. The circuit boards, stuffed, are about 12mm tall, plus 1.5mm for the board and .5 mm for solder clearance on the back. On a 330 there is about 1" clear space inside the guitar to the underside of the Rowlux. There's not a clearance problem except at the board. I have a much more elegant solution devised for the board clearance problem. With this solution, I can now place LEDs around the pots to eliminate the dead spot in the prototype guitar (seen in my avatar and video).
